When stratified by sex, this study showed a trend toward higher sarcopenia prevalence in women with elevated TFAM levels, albeit this did not reach statistical significance ( p = 0.07).
Although the effect sizes were consistent with the overall association, these results did not reach statistical significance in sex-specific analyses, potentially reflecting reduced statistical power in the stratified subgroups.
In men, those in the higher TFAM quartiles exhibited a greater prevalence of sarcopenia compared to the lowest quartile, though this association was not statistically significant despite a positive trend (OR = 2.02).
